Mitigating the Threat: Best Practices
To defend against Honey Gold Raw Attacks, organizations and individuals should adopt a multi-layered approach:
- Employee Training: Regularly educate staff on phishing tactics and the importance of verifying requests.
- Multi-Factor Authentication (MFA): Implement MFA to add an extra layer of security for account access.
- Endpoint Protection: Deploy advanced antivirus and anti-malware solutions with real-time threat detection.
- Email Filtering: Use robust email filters to block suspicious messages before they reach users.
- Incident Response Planning: Establish clear protocols for identifying, containing, and recovering from attacks.
